Minnewaska Mountain House

You will stay in a house that forms part of the history of the Gunks, and today makes a perfect base for hikers, climbers, runners, cyclists and cross-country skiers. The 65-mile network of carriage roads in Minnewaska State Park Preserve and the Mohonk Preserve is accessible just a few hundred yards from a historic modernized house. You can explore swimming holes and lakes, many miles of more rugged trails, and the popular climbing area (Gunks) of Peter’s Kill, just a 5-minute walk away.
